Surf's up, beach lovers! Get ready for a sizzling Sunday along the West Central and Southwest Florida coastline. We're looking at a mostly sunny day with temperatures climbing into the mid to upper 80s and water temps matching that summer warmth.
While the surf remains calm with waves barely touching a foot, don't let the tranquil surface fool you. Thunderstorms are brewing and ready to make a splash throughout the day. The UV index is cranking up to very high, so sunscreen is your best friend today!
Winds will start from the east around 5 mph, then swing southwest in the afternoon, keeping things interesting. From Cedar Key to Fort Myers Beach, expect scattered to numerous showers popping up like uninvited beach party guests.
As the day transitions into night, the thunderstorm potential doesn't take a break. Partly cloudy skies will give way to mostly cloudy conditions with a continued chance of rain. Temperatures will cool down just a bit to the mid to upper 70s, but the tropical vibes remain strong.
Monday continues the summer symphony with partly sunny skies and more thunderstorm chances. Winds will shift to the northeast and east, bringing that classic Florida coastal feel. Water temperatures are still sitting pretty in the mid to upper 80s.
Pro tip for beach-goers: While the rip current risk is low today, always stay alert near jetties, piers, and reefs. These areas can create sneaky current conditions that can catch even experienced swimmers off guard.
